骨瘤切除后慢性骨髓炎的长期随访
Hiroaki Kimura1, Hisaki Aiba1, Shiro Saito1
1Department of Orthopedic Surgery, Nagoya City University, Nagoya, Japan.
概括
骨瘤手术后的慢性骨髓炎带来了独特的挑战. 管理需要仔细考虑激进手术与保守的方法,重点关注生物膜控制和软组织感染.
